[Bug 1725522] [NEW] dpkg - Swedish - err? column name incorrect
Gunnar Hjalmarsson (gunnarhj) has assigned this bug to you for Ubuntu Translations:
dpkg -l
outputs:
Önskat=Okänd(U)/Installera(I)/Radera(R)/Rensa(P)/Håll(H)
| Status.=Ej inst.(N)/(I)nst./Konffil.(C)/(U)ppack./Halvkonf.(F)/(H)alvinst.
| / Vänt.utl(W)/Föresl.utl(T)
|/ Fel?Inget(=)/Ominstallera(R)/Båda(X) (Status,Fel: versaler=illa)
The fourth line starts with "Fel?Inget(=)" but the English version reads "Err?=(none)". I get the impression that the translation should say "Fel?=(inget)".
Granted, the whole thing is pretty hard to read anyway.
